>>
>> Yeah, this is ghastly.
>>
>> Look at 
>>
>>      {
>>              .procname       = "numa_balancing",
>>              .data           = NULL, /* filled in by handler */
>>              .maxlen         = sizeof(unsigned int),
>>              .mode           = 0644,
>>              .proc_handler   = sysctl_numa_balancing,
>>              .extra1         = &zero,
>>              .extra2         = &one,
>>      },
>>
>> Now extra1 points at a long and extra2 points at an int. 
>> sysctl_numa_balancing() calls proc_dointvec_minmax() and I think your
>> patch just broke big-endian 64-bit machines.  "sched_autogroup_enabled"
>> breaks as well.
> 
> Taking another look at this...
> 
> numa_balancing will continue to work on big-endian because of course
> zero is still zero when byteswapped.  But that's such a hack, isn't
> documented and doesn't work for "one", "sixty", etc.
> 

Yeah, I agree it's a bit hacky.

> I'm thinking a better fix here is to switch hugetlb_sysctl_handler to
> use `int's.  2^32 hugepages is enough for anybody.
> 

It's 8 petabytes for 2MB pages, so yeah should be enough.
Perhaps it also makes sense to change types for counters in 'struct hstate' 
from longs to ints.



> hugetlb_overcommit_handler() will need conversion also.
> 
> Perhaps auditing all the proc_doulongvec_minmax callsites is the way to
> attack this.
> 

I've looked through this yesterday and didn't found anything obviously wrong.
Though I could easily miss something.
